Key Features to Look for in a High Capacity Humidifier

When shopping for a high capacity humidifier, there are several key features to look for. First and foremost, you’ll want to consider the coverage area of the device. Look for a humidifier that can cover the square footage of your home or office, and make sure it’s designed for large spaces. You’ll also want to consider the moisture output of the device, which is typically measured in gallons per day. A higher moisture output will be necessary for larger spaces or for people who live in areas with very dry air.

Another important feature to look for is the type of humidifier. There are several types of humidifiers on the market, including cool mist, warm mist, and ultrasonic. Cool mist humidifiers are great for large spaces and can be more energy-efficient than warm mist humidifiers. Ultrasonic humidifiers, on the other hand, use high-frequency sound waves to create a fine mist, which can be more effective at relieving congestion and coughs. Consider your specific needs and preferences when choosing a type of humidifier.

Tips for Using and Maintaining Your High Capacity Humidifier

Using and maintaining a high capacity humidifier requires some basic knowledge and care. First and foremost, make sure to follow the manufacturer’s instructions for use and maintenance. This will typically include filling the tank with water, setting the humidity level, and cleaning the device regularly. You’ll also want to make sure to use distilled water in your humidifier, which can help to prevent mineral buildup and reduce maintenance costs over time.

In addition to following the manufacturer’s instructions, you’ll also want to consider the humidity level in your home. The ideal humidity level will depend on the specific climate and conditions in your area, but a general rule of thumb is to aim for a humidity level between 30-50%. You can use a hygrometer to measure the humidity level in your home and adjust the humidifier accordingly. This will help to ensure that you’re getting the most benefit from your device and preventing over-humidification.

Humidistat and Automatic Shut-Off

Another key factor to consider when buying a humidifier is the humidistat and automatic shut-off feature. A humidistat is a device that measures the humidity level in the air and adjusts the humidifier’s output accordingly. This ensures that the air in your home is always at a comfortable humidity level, and prevents over-humidification which can lead to mold and mildew. An automatic shut-off feature, on the other hand, turns off the humidifier when the desired humidity level is reached, or when the water tank is empty. This helps to conserve energy and prevent accidents.

What are the different types of high capacity humidifiers available?

There are several types of high capacity humidifiers available, each with its unique benefits and features. Cool mist humidifiers, for example, use a fan to blow air through a wet wick or filter, creating a cool mist that’s released into the air. Warm mist humidifiers, on the other hand, use a heating element to warm the water before releasing it into the air as a warm mist. Ultrasonic humidifiers use high-frequency sound waves to create a fine mist that’s released into the air, and are often considered to be the most efficient and effective type of humidifier.
